Output 22638d37c811369246afff76a3f432b4f9aeb2506c7a1301ad87e2e51dd2e104:8

value
17598327
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1582b70e996bc76f10f9f2571cbb8219f1709e5b OP_EQUALVERIFY OP_CHECKSIG
address
12xjnGguTB691o2FSLYYsUmz4Dh3fZqww7
transaction
22638d37c811369246afff76a3f432b4f9aeb2506c7a1301ad87e2e51dd2e104
spent
true